検索
Results of 1 - 10 of about 106 for let (0.026 sec.)
- パターンが使用されることのある箇所全部 - Rust 日本語版 10280
- The Rust Programming Language 日本語版 まえがき はじめに 1. 事始め 1.1. インストール 1.2. Hello,
...
Enumを定義する 6.2. match制御フロー演算子 6.3. if letで簡潔な制御フロー 7. 肥大化していくプロジェクトをパ...
パターンで値を無視する」節で講義します。 条件分岐 if let 式 第6章で主に if let 式を1つの場合にしか合致しない...
て使用する方法を議論しました。 オプションとして、 if let には if let のパターンが合致しない時に走るコードを...
含む対応する else も用意できます。 リスト18-1は、 if let 、 else if 、 else if let 式を混ぜてマッチさせるこ...
- https://man.plustar.jp/rust/book/ch18-01-all-the-places-for-patterns.html - [similar]
- スライス型 - Rust 日本語版 10049
- The Rust Programming Language 日本語版 まえがき はじめに 1. 事始め 1.1. インストール 1.2. Hello,
...
Enumを定義する 6.2. match制御フロー演算子 6.3. if letで簡潔な制御フロー 7. 肥大化していくプロジェクトをパ...
: src/main.rs fn first_word(s: &String) -> usize { let bytes = s.as_bytes(); for (i, &item) in bytes.iter...
換しています。 fn first_word(s: &String) -> usize { let bytes = s.as_bytes(); for (i, &item) in bytes.iter...
生成しています: fn first_word(s: &String) -> usize { let bytes = s.as_bytes(); for (i, &item) in bytes.iter...
- https://man.plustar.jp/rust/book/ch04-03-slices.html - [similar]
- 文字列でUTF-8でエンコードされたテキストを保持する - Rust 日本語版 9408
- The Rust Programming Language 日本語版 まえがき はじめに 1. 事始め 1.1. インストール 1.2. Hello,
...
Enumを定義する 6.2. match制御フロー演算子 6.3. if letで簡潔な制御フロー 7. 肥大化していくプロジェクトをパ...
に示したようにですね。 #![allow(unused)] fn main() { let mut s = String::new(); } リスト8-11: 新しい空の St...
に2例、示しています。 #![allow(unused)] fn main() { let data = "initial contents"; let s = data.to_string(...
); // the method also works on a literal directly: let s = "initial contents".to_string(); } リスト8-12:...
- https://man.plustar.jp/rust/book/ch08-02-strings.html - [similar]
- 論駁可能性:パターンが合致しないかどうか - Rust 日本語版 9293
- The Rust Programming Language 日本語版 まえがき はじめに 1. 事始め 1.1. インストール 1.2. Hello,
...
Enumを定義する 6.2. match制御フロー演算子 6.3. if letで簡潔な制御フロー 7. 肥大化していくプロジェクトをパ...
る値に合致するパターンは、 論駁不可能 なものです。文 let x = 5; の x は一例でしょう。 x は何にでも合致し、故...
あるパターンは、 論駁可能 なものです。 一例は、式 if let Some(x) = a_value の Some(x) になるでしょう; a_val...
x) パターンは合致しないでしょうから。 関数の引数、 let 文、 for ループは、値が合致しなかったら何も意味のあ...
- https://man.plustar.jp/rust/book/ch18-02-refutability.html - [similar]
- if letで簡潔な制御フロー - Rust 日本語版 9177
- The Rust Programming Language 日本語版 まえがき はじめに 1. 事始め 1.1. インストール 1.2. Hello,
...
Enumを定義する 6.2. match制御フロー演算子 6.3. if letで簡潔な制御フロー 7. 肥大化していくプロジェクトをパ...
Navy Ayu The Rust Programming Language 日本語版 if let で簡潔な制御フロー if let 記法で if と let をより冗...
ラムを考えてください。 #![allow(unused)] fn main() { let some_u8_value = Some(0u8); match some_u8_value { S...
、追加すべき定型コードが多すぎます。 その代わり、 if let を使用してもっと短く書くことができます。以下のコー...
- https://man.plustar.jp/rust/book/ch06-03-if-let.html - [similar]
- The Rust Programming Language 日本語版 9177
- The Rust Programming Language 日本語版 まえがき はじめに 1. 事始め 1.1. インストール 1.2. Hello,
...
Enumを定義する 6.2. match制御フロー演算子 6.3. if letで簡潔な制御フロー 7. 肥大化していくプロジェクトをパ...
メソッドについて議論し、第6章はenum、 match 式、 if let 制御フロー構文を講義します。 構造体とenumを使用して...
、実際のプログラムでの使い方を示しながら紹介します。 let 、 match 、メソッド、関連関数、外部クレートの使いか...
ase input your guess."); // ほら、予想を入力してね let mut guess = String::new(); io::stdin() .read_line(...
- https://man.plustar.jp/rust/book/print.html - [similar]
- 関数 - Rust 日本語版 9100
- The Rust Programming Language 日本語版 まえがき はじめに 1. 事始め 1.1. インストール 1.2. Hello,
...
Enumを定義する 6.2. match制御フロー演算子 6.3. if letで簡潔な制御フロー 7. 肥大化していくプロジェクトをパ...
結果値に評価されます。ちょっと例を眺めてみましょう。 let キーワードを使用して変数を生成し、値を代入すること...
は文になります。 リスト3-1で let y = 6; は文です。 ファイル名: src/main.rs fn main(...
) { let y = 6; } リスト3-1: 1文を含む main 関数宣言 関数定...
- https://man.plustar.jp/rust/book/ch03-03-how-functions-work.html - [similar]
- ライフタイムで参照を検証する - Rust 日本語版 9036
- The Rust Programming Language 日本語版 まえがき はじめに 1. 事始め 1.1. インストール 1.2. Hello,
...
Enumを定義する 6.2. match制御フロー演算子 6.3. if letで簡潔な制御フロー 7. 肥大化していくプロジェクトをパ...
ープと内側のスコープが含まれています。 fn main() { { let r; { let x = 5; r = &x; } println!("r: {}", r); }...
フタイムを表示する注釈が付いています。 fn main() { { let r; // ---------+-- 'a // | { // | let x = 5; // -+...
くなり、エラーなくコンパイルできます。 fn main() { { let x = 5; // ----------+-- 'b // | let r = &x; // --+...
- https://man.plustar.jp/rust/book/ch10-03-lifetime-syntax.html - [similar]
- データ型 - Rust 日本語版 8998
- The Rust Programming Language 日本語版 まえがき はじめに 1. 事始め 1.1. インストール 1.2. Hello,
...
Enumを定義する 6.2. match制御フロー演算子 6.3. if letで簡潔な制御フロー 7. 肥大化していくプロジェクトをパ...
。以下のようにですね: #![allow(unused)] fn main() { let guess: u32 = "42".parse().expect("Not a number!");...
eeded (型注釈が必要です) --> src/main.rs:2:9 | 2 | let guess = "42".parse().expect("Not a number!"); | ^^...
をご覧ください: ファイル名: src/main.rs fn main() { let x = 2.0; // f64 let y: f32 = 3.0; // f32 } 浮動小数...
- https://man.plustar.jp/rust/book/ch03-02-data-types.html - [similar]
- 参照と借用 - Rust 日本語版 8613
- The Rust Programming Language 日本語版 まえがき はじめに 1. 事始め 1.1. インストール 1.2. Hello,
...
Enumを定義する 6.2. match制御フロー演算子 6.3. if letで簡潔な制御フロー 7. 肥大化していくプロジェクトをパ...
見てみましょう: ファイル名: src/main.rs fn main() { let s1 = String::from("hello"); let len = calculate_le...
calculate_length(s: &String) -> usize { s.len() } let s1 = String::from("hello"); let len = calculate_le...
意: 動きません! ファイル名: src/main.rs fn main() { let s = String::from("hello"); change(&s); } fn change...
- https://man.plustar.jp/rust/book/ch04-02-references-and-borrowing.html - [similar]